Crossing Borders, a
Peabody award-winning documentary, offers a fresh look at America's immigration debate. On the Public Radio Exchange,
reviewer Emon Hassan had this to say about Crossing Borders:
"There's a line, I learned of from this piece, that's often said by the Chicanos, "We didn't cross the borders, the borders crossed us." It's a statement heavily drenched in sadness and frustration. That statement is a historical fact. It begs the question, have Mexicans been crossing borders to find a better life, or have they always been 'crossing' to find their way back home? That 'philosophical' introduction was necessary to help you understand this piece, or, rather, a collage of pieces."
